Hi,
The path to platform SDK should end with any one of the (iPhoneOSx.x | iPhoneSimulatorx.x | AppleTVSimulatorx.x | AppleTVOSx.x) format to avoid any unintended behavior. Please use latest AIR 32 Beta( https://labs.adobe.com/downloads/air.html) and let us know if you still face problem.
